Re: RPM problem: How do I properly update glibc?



Hi Chuck,

> If I have messed up and installed an i386 version of package-X, then
> followed by installing the i686 version of package-X are they both there, or
> did the second install actually overwrite the binary executable image?

 In this case the files all have the same names, so they will be all 
replaced with the files in the package you last added.

> In the case of glibc, I don't want to remove the only current version from
> the last (i686) install, so how do I clean up the rpmdatabase?

 rpm --justdb -e glibc-2.3.2-5 glibc-common-2.3.2-5

 I assume both version of the glibc packages contain the same files, so you 
only need to update the rpmdb. If not delete leftover files from the old 
package by hand.
